This book offers valuable insights into the management of uncertainty and business enterprises risk. Propelled by clear construct and communication, Nishimura introduces an innovate model (COLC) that embodies forward-looking, globalized understandings of how managers can exploit profit opportunities, transform risk into profit opportunities, and minimize enterprise risk. This book is for every manager who is serious about promoting business competitiveness and success. --Ralph Adler, Professor, Department of Accountancy & Finance, University of Otago, New Zealand Nishimura's discussion on the need for feed forward control in today's dynamic and uncertain world is exceptionally brilliant. The emphasis on the need for strategic management accounting tools to transform risk into profit opportunities is well articulated. Indeed, this thought provoking book is a "must read" for any business wanting to remain competitive, be it SMEs or multinational organizations. --Maliah Sulaiman, Professor, Faculty of Economic and Management Science, International Islamic University, Malaysia This book brings together Nishimura's considerable knowledge, developed over a long and illustrious career, of the discipline of management accounting across a wide range of topics. These include such matters as strategic innovation, uncertainty and risk, together with feed-forward control, cost design and opportunity control. The book provides an invaluable insight into ideas underpinning Japanese management accounting that are often very different to those encountered elsewhere in the accounting literature. --Roger Willett, Professor, School of Accounting and Commercial Law, Victoria University of Wellington, New Zealand This book is a capstone to the magisterial career of one of Japan's most senior scholars of risk, accounting, and management. How can companies and organizations navigate today's world, rife with unexpected challenges and opportunities? In this trenchant book, Nishimura offers case studies, theoretical models, and useful strategies for the new normal. This book will be useful to scholars, businesspeople, and bankers. Akira Nishimura, Emeritus Professor of Kyushu University and Visiting Professor of Beppu University, has published numerous books on management accounting. He previously served as President of Beppu University and Dean of Faculty of Economics at Kyushu University.
